Graded #363 · C
Strengths
- Broad compounded GLP-1 menu — semaglutide (+B12), tirzepatide, oral semaglutide/tirzepatide capsules, plus Lipo-B
- Large peptide/longevity catalog (BPC-157, GHK-Cu, NAD+, MOTS-C) across injectable, oral, topical, and nasal formats
- Clinician-guided, compounded at FDA-registered pharmacies; partners with a licensed physician network (Samaritan MD)
- Full legal suite published (Terms, Privacy, HIPAA Notice, CCPA, Returns & Refunds)
Where it loses points
- Pricing not shown upfront — revealed only at checkout after a dose selection
- Offers investigational/research compounds (e.g., retatrutide, AOD-9604) that are not FDA-approved
- Compounding pharmacy partner not named ('FDA-registered pharmacies')
- Not LegitScript-certified (no certification displayed)
Graded #365 · C
Strengths
- GLP-1 specialist — not a multi-category telehealth
- Price includes unlimited doctor consultations, monthly group calls, and a dietitian consultation
- Both semaglutide and tirzepatide available
- Multi-month discount on quarterly billing
- Claims 450,000+ enrolled
Where it loses points
- No visible LegitScript or PCAB accreditation
- Above-average pricing ($250–$390/mo)
- Compounded only — no brand-name options
- Now serves 49 U.S. states (one state excluded; specific exclusion not named)
